STATE EX REL. NELSON v. RUSSO

No. 99-2133.

89 Ohio St.3d 227 (2000)

THE STATE EX REL. NELSON, APPELLANT, v. RUSSO, JUDGE, APPELLEE.

Supreme Court of Ohio.

Decided June 28, 2000.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Carl A. Nelson, Jr., pro se.

William D. Mason, Cuyahoga County Prosecuting Attorney, and Diane Smilanick, Assistant Prosecuting Attorney, for appellee.


Per Curiam.

Nelson asserts that the court of appeals erred in denying the writ because it improperly sua sponte converted Judge's Russo's motion to dismiss to a motion for summary judgment without notifying him of the conversion and giving him an opportunity to respond.
